2013 PGK to RWF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2013

During 2013, the PGK to RWF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 25, valuing the pair at 317.3296.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on October 4, dropping to 252.3143.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 65.0153 RWF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 299.1184 to the December average rate of 268.7844, the exchange rate registered a net change of -10.14%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2013 high of 317.3296 was up 3.54% compared to the 2012 peak of 306.4703,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 299.0744, compared to 269.6495 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 29.4249 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2013 was February, with a trading range of 21.0208 RWF (High: 317.3296 / Low: 296.3088).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 6.3048 RWF (High: 262.6046 / Low: 256.2998).
